1. Clinical prediction score for superficial surgical site infections: Real‐life data from a retrospective single‐centre analysis of 812 hepatectomies

Superficial surgical site infections (SSIs) are one of the most common postoperative complications of hepatectomy for liver cancer. The objective of this study is to clarify the risk factors and determine a clinical prediction score for SSIs after partial hepatectomy for malignant tumour. A total of 812 consecutive patients were enrolled who underwent partial hepatectomy for liver malignant tumour from January 2017 to December 2017. Univariate and multivariate analyses were conducted to identify the risk factors for SSIs. Clinical prediction score was then constructed using coefficients of identified significant predictors. Risk stratification was then carried out by receiver operating characteristic curve analysis. Of all the 812 patients, SSIs were observed in 31 (3.82%) patients.
